About the role
The Wheelchair Agent is responsible for assisting passengers with mobility needs throughout the airport terminal in a safe, courteous, and professional manner. This role provides wheelchair transportation and customer support to ensure passengers receive timely assistance from check-in through boarding, connections, arrival, and baggage claim.
Responsibilities
- Assist passengers requiring wheelchair or mobility assistance throughout the airport
- Transport passengers safely between ticket counters, security checkpoints, gates, baggage claim, and connecting flights
- Assist passengers with boarding and deplaning aircraft when required
- Provide excellent customer service and professional communication to passengers and families
- Assist elderly passengers, individuals with disabilities, and travelers requiring special assistance
- Handle wheelchairs and mobility equipment safely and properly
- Coordinate with gate agents, airline staff, and airport personnel to ensure timely passenger assistance
- Respond promptly to wheelchair service requests and maintain efficient passenger flow
- Assist with light baggage handling when necessary
- Follow all airport safety procedures, airline policies, and TSA regulations
- Report operational concerns, passenger incidents, or equipment issues to supervisors promptly
- Maintain professionalism, patience, and sensitivity while assisting passengers
- Perform other duties as requested

Work Environment
- Airport terminals, gates, security checkpoints, and baggage claim areas
- Fast-paced environment with frequent passenger interaction
- Requires extensive walking throughout airport terminals
- Exposure to crowded and high-traffic passenger areas
- Ability to push passengers in wheelchairs for extended periods
- Ability to stand and walk continuously throughout shifts
- Ability to lift, push, and pull up to 50 pounds occasionally
- Ability to assist passengers safely during boarding and deplaning operations
